This enrichment activity introduces Grade 4 and 5 students to the exciting world of digital design and journalism using Canva. Students will learn how to create eye-catching graphics, presentations, posters, newsletters, and more while exploring the fundamentals of visual communication and storytelling. They will also experiment with digital journalism by designing articles, interviews, and reports that share ideas and information with a wider audience. Through hands-on projects, they will develop skills in layout, color, typography, and narrative flow, all while expressing their creativity in meaningful ways. Collaboration and peer feedback will play an important role, encouraging students to share ideas and refine their designs. By the end of the course, students will have built a digital portfolio showcasing their work and will gain confidence in using design and journalism as powerful tools for communication and self-expression.
